What does the competition trigger group actually provide over the stock trigger group? How does it alter the operation?
The competition trigger group has different types of coating on the fire control unit frame, the hammer and a few other moving parts. This adds a lubricity that makes it a little slicker so that even when it is not lubricated it is more slick.
The competition trigger group comes with a stock weight hammer spring that is no lighter than stock, but it is coated for lubricity.
This results in no change in the double action. But it will reduce the weight of the single action pull, usually by almost a pound.
